SAN DIEGO — Sharp HealthCare and Sharp Rees-Stealy have made their convenient online patient portal, mySharp, available as an app for iPhone®, iPad® and iPod touch®. Sharp Rees-Stealy patients and those who manage the care of Sharp Rees-Stealy patients will be able to use the app to:
  • Schedule, cancel, and view upcoming and past appointments
  • Get directions and maps
  • Send a message to the doctor's office
  • View selected lab results
  • Pay bills in full, view invoice details, view available statements and payment history
  • See allergies, conditions, immunizations, medications and vital signs

"We launched mySharp in 2010, and since then nearly 80,000 people have signed up to manage their health care or the care of their loved one online," said Stacey Hrountas, CEO of Sharp Rees-Stealy, which is consistently ranked as one of California's top-performing medical groups with 20 locations throughout San Diego. "Sharp Rees-Stealy patients enjoy the convenience of contacting their doctor's office, checking lab results, scheduling appointments and more, when it's convenient for them. This new app now gives patients secure, easy access wherever they have a wireless connection."

Sharp Rees-Stealy patients with an existing mySharp account can download the free app by searching "mySharp" on the App Store from any Apple device or by logging into their iTunes account. Sharp Rees-Stealy patients new to mySharp will need to sign up for an account by visiting mySharp.sharp.com from a computer before they can obtain the app. An Android app is set to be released later this year.

About Sharp
Selected as one of 32 Pioneer Accountable Care Organizations by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) and a 2007 Malcolm Baldrige National Quality Award recipient, Sharp HealthCare is San Diego's most comprehensive health care delivery system.  It is recognized for clinical excellence for services in cardiac, cancer and multiorgan transplantation, as well as orthopedics, rehabilitation, behavioral health and women's health. Sharp HealthCare has been widely acclaimed for its commitment to transform the health care experience for patients, physicians and staff through an organization-wide performance improvement initiative called The Sharp Experience. The Sharp system includes four acute-care hospitals, three specialty hospitals, two affiliated medical groups and a health plan. To learn more about Sharp, visit www.sharp.com.
